Dr. Mize has more than 15 years experience in Biotechnology with extensive experience in novel genomics and proteomics applications, innovative technology implementation, and expertise in Pharmacogenomics and Pharmacoproteomics. Her experience also includes drug and peptide modeling (QSAR for toxicity), microarray Genechip analysis, and Mass Spectroscopy. As a consultant, Dr. Mize has reviewed and appraised technologies for several startup Biotechnology companies, composed business plans and prepared slideware. As Director of Protein Bioinformatics at Hyseq Pharmaceuticals, a Genomics company, she created and supervised three groups: Computational Biology, Intellectual Property Informatics, and Data Integration. Previously, Dr. Mize was research scientist at Ciphergen Biosystems, a Proteomics company, and staff scientist at Alza Corp. She received her B.S. from the University of California, Berkeley, and her Ph.D. from the University of California, San Francisco. Subsequently, she completed postdoctoral studies in the Cell Biology Programme at the European Molecular Biology Laboratory (EMBL, GenBank), Heidelberg, Germany, and at Genentech in the Department of Molecular Biology. In the course of her work at Ciphergen and Hyseq Pharmaceuticals, Dr. Mize holds more than 25 U.S. and European patent applications, with 4 issued patents to date.
